Reversal patterns are key indicators that signal a potential change in the direction of a trend. Bullish reversal patterns, such as the hammer candlestick and morning star formation, suggest that a downtrend may be coming to an end and a new uptrend is likely to begin. On the other hand, bearish reversal patterns, like the shooting star pattern and evening star formation, indicate that an uptrend may be losing steam and a downtrend could be on the horizon. By recognizing these patterns early on, traders can capitalize on potential trend reversals and make profitable trades.

Doji candlesticks are another important tool in technical analysis, representing indecision in the market. When a doji appears on a chart, it signals that buyers and sellers are evenly matched, and a potential reversal may be imminent. Engulfing patterns, on the other hand, occur when a large candle completely engulfs the previous candle, indicating a shift in momentum and a possible trend reversal.

In addition to these candlestick formations, technical analysis also involves the use of indicators such as moving averages, the Relative Strength Index (RSI), and volume analysis to confirm trends and identify potential entry and exit points. Support and resistance levels are also critical in technical analysis, as they help traders determine key price points where a stock is likely to reverse direction.
